The STM32F103V8T6 belongs to the family of ARM Cortex-M3 microcontrollers and is manufactured by STMicroelectronics. The STM32F103V8T6 operates based on the ARM Cortex-M3 architecture, utilizing its core to execute instructions and manage peripherals. It follows the principles of embedded system design and real-time processing.
The STM32F103V8T6 is well-suited for a wide range of applications including: - Industrial automation - Motor control - Consumer electronics - Internet of Things (IoT) devices
